Statement as of 5:06 am PST on November 23, 2008

Dense Fog Advisory


... Dense fog advisory is cancelled for the central and southern
Willamette valleys...

The National Weather Service in Portland has cancelled the dense
fog advisory.

The fog has lifted into a low overcast in most of the central and
southern Willamette valleys early this morning and visibilities
were generally 2 miles or greater. A few pockets of locally dense
fog may still exist with local visibilities one quarter mile or
less... so continue to use caution and slow down while driving if
you encounter a patch of locally dense fog this morning.
